150TH ANNIVERSARY OF OUR DIOCESE - Historical Facts: St. Michael’s Church opens in 1860. Fr. Michael Gallagher purchases a lot on the grounds of the Springfield Armory for $7,250 to construct St. Michael’s Church which he names after himself. Built at a cost of $75,000, it opens on Christmas Day 1861, amid the darkest days of the Civil War in the presence of the largest congregation of Catholics ever assembled in Springfield.
